What is a DIY Moroccan Hammam?

The Ancient Origins of Moroccan Hammam

The Moroccan Hammam is more than a bath — it’s a sacred cleansing ritual that originated centuries ago in North Africa. Inspired by Roman bathhouses, it evolved into a holistic wellness experience focusing on detoxification, purification, and spiritual renewal.

Core Elements of a Home Hammam Experience

To recreate this ritual at home, you’ll need steam, exfoliation tools, black soap, and soothing body oils. Add sound therapy and you transform this traditional cleanse into a full sensory retreat. Learn more about at-home Hammam essentials at DIY Moroccan Hammam.

8 Sound Therapy Tips to Elevate Your DIY Hammam Experience

1. Choose Calming Ambient Music for Your Hammam Space

Start your Hammam session with gentle ambient music that sets a tranquil mood. Choose soft melodies or Moroccan-inspired instrumentals to match your ritual’s cultural roots. Curate music that blends with your chosen spa lighting and aromatherapy scents.

2. Incorporate Nature Sounds for Deep Relaxation

Nothing soothes the soul quite like the sound of nature. Rainfall, ocean waves, or rustling leaves mimic the eco-friendly spa atmosphere found in high-end resorts. These sounds can help synchronize your breathing and ease your mind.

3. Try Singing Bowls or Chimes for Vibrational Healing

Using singing bowls or tuning chimes creates vibrations that resonate through your body. The frequencies align with your chakras, enhancing both relaxation and energy flow — a concept deeply rooted in healing traditions.

4. Create a Sound Bath Session During Steam Rituals

During the steam phase of your Hammam, surround yourself with low-frequency soundscapes. The combination of steam and sound amplifies relaxation, opening your pores while balancing your energy. Try pairing this with herbal steam blends from Herbal Natural Remedies.

5. Use Guided Meditation Soundtracks for Emotional Balance

Guided meditations layered with soothing background music can guide your mind into a peaceful state. Combine this with your body polish or cleansing ritual for maximum emotional detox.

6. Pair Aromatherapy with Sound for Multisensory Bliss

A perfect Hammam blends healing scents and sound. Use essential oils like lavender, rose, or eucalyptus. You can explore combinations of aromatherapy and essential oils at Whispering Aura’s Aromatherapy Collection.

7. Balance Silence and Sound for True Mindfulness

Alternate between moments of serene silence and harmonious sound. This balance sharpens your spa mindfulness and helps you fully absorb the peaceful ambience. Silence is, after all, the space where healing begins.

8. Build a Personalized Hammam Sound Playlist

Create a playlist that reflects your emotional rhythm — a mix of nature sounds, slow beats, and instrumental pieces. You can even add affirmations or healing mantras for a deeply personal experience. This transforms your Hammam into your private temple of sound and serenity.
